| Singer on causing death charge gets back licence |

SINGER Jessica Xavier, 27, who is faced with a causing death by dangerous driving charge last March 5, made another appearance before Magistrate Alex Moore at Sparendaam Court yesterday.
Her lawyer, Mr. Marcel Bobb requested that she be given back her driver’s licence, as she needs it to attend to important work at Lethem, in Rupununi District.The magistrate granted the request but ordered Xavier to lodge her passport and return to court on June 7. The allegation against Xavier, who is on self-bail, said that, last February 26, at Mon Repos Public Road, also on East Coast Demerara, she drove a vehicle in a reckless manner and caused the death of 20-year-old Vangaskar Ramcharitar. |
